BACKGROUND OF THE INVENTION AND PRIOR ART The present invention relates to a forwarder and to a method of handling pieces of wood according to the preambles of the appended independent claims. In deforestation according to the short timber method, which is usually carried out with the help of a harvester, a forwarder is used to pick up the pieces of timber that have been loosened during felling on the ground. A forwarder is a vehicle equipped with a crane with a gripping unit and a load space for receiving and transporting pieces of wood lifted via the gripping unit. The forwarder transports the pieces of wood to a unloading site, a so-called dump, for example at a forest truck, where they are loaded from the cargo hold and later picked up by, for example, a timber truck. The pieces of wood resulting from felling that are to be taken up by the forwarder's gripper unit can be laid divided into heaps according to different assortments, eg spruce timber, pine timber and birch timber according to different dimensions and lengths and softwood and birch mass, but a large number of additional assortments are conceivable. This division into assortments carried out in connection with the felling is made so that later loading of the timber pieces on a timber truck at the said offshoot can be done with different assortments separated so that the timber truck can efficiently transport the timber bits to the addressees and the respective assortments. In order to achieve a supply of the pieces of wood divided into different assortments of said offshoots, two different approaches have been used so far. The first has involved gripping via the forwarder's gripping means of a hog with pieces of wood according to an assortment and laying down this pasture in a part of the forwarder's cargo space and then when gripping pieces of wood of another assortment laying down these in another part of the cargo space to keep the different assortments separated from each other in the cargo space. The second approach used has been to grasp a pile of pieces of wood of one assortment by means of the gripping unit and if the gripping unit has room for more pieces of wood in its annular space, the gripping unit is moved to another heap and gripped thereof also in the case of another assortment of these pieces of wood. Darpa, the whole bundle of seized pieces of wood has been laid down in the cargo space and the pieces of wood there have been sorted to separate the assortments. SUMMARY OF THE INVENTION The object of the present invention is to provide a forwarder of an initially defined type which enables a more efficient handling of pieces of wood divided after felling into different assortments than according to the procedure described above. This object is achieved according to the invention by providing such a forwarder provided with the features drawn up in the jug-drawing part of appended claim 1. By providing the gripping unit with said at least one extra gripping arm in the manner according to the invention, it becomes possible, after gripping pieces of wood according to a first assortment, if there is space for it in the annular space defined by the gripping means to grab an additional bundle or hay with pieces of wood. if these were of a different assortment and then lead the seized pieces of timber to the forwarder's cargo space and then in turn load the timber pieces according to the different assortments in the designated places in the cargo space without performing flag sorting in the cargo space. As a result, a larger amount of pieces of wood can be handled in a selected "crane cycle" and the forwarder's cargo space is filled with pieces of wood divided into different assortments in a shorter time than has hitherto been possible with a conventional forwarder using any of the above procedures. At the same time, the certainty of the separation of the various ranges is increased. It is pointed out that the gripping assembly of the forwarder according to the invention can of course be used to grip pieces of wood according to one and the same assortment and feed them to the cargo space if desired or to seize pieces of wood which have been placed in heaps during felling containing a mixture of assortments. DETAILED DESCRIPTION OF EMBODIMENTS OF THE INVENTION Fig. 1a schematically illustrates a conventional forwarder 1 provided with a cargo space 2 for receiving and transporting pieces of wood divided into different assortments. It is indicated that in the cargo hold there is already a batch of pieces of wood of two different assortments 3, 4 closed. Of course, it is also possible to fill the cargo space with pieces of wood of a single range. The forwarder further has a crane 5 with a gripping unit 6 for lifting pieces of wood from the ground and placing them in the cargo space. The different assortments often consist of falling lengths in the same load, ie simultaneously in the load space, for example from 2.7 m to 5.5 m. Fig. 1b shows a load space from behind and how separator struts S are used to separate the different assortments 3,3 ', 4 at. The forwarder is an off-road vehicle or a forestry machine (it can not be used in a combined harvester / forwarder) that is used for off-road transport, so-called forwarding, of pieces of wood from a felling site in vaglos terrain to a storage area accessible by a timber truck or other rocking vehicles. The function of a forwarder according to the invention provided with the gripping unit just described will now be explained with reference to Figs. 3-8. At a felling site, pieces of wood can lie on the ground divided into piles with pieces of wood of one and the same range, such as spruce timber, pine timber, softwood, birch pulp and firewood, at the same height. When the forwarder is to place such pieces of wood in its load space via its crane and gripping unit 8, the gripping means 7, 8 are swung apart, as shown in Fig. 3, and the gripping unit is lowered to the ground so that the extra gripping arms 13, 14 come around a hog of pieces of wood 19 of a first assortment, warp the gripping arms 13, 14 to the gripping layer shown in Fig. 4 for gripping the pieces of wood 19 and holding them in the subspace 17 defined by the gripping arms 13, 14 and the body 9 of the gripping assembly. Then the gripping unit is moved via the crane to a heap with pieces of wood 20 according to a second assortment and lowered so that the gripping means 7, 8 surround the heap and can then be led to its gripping layer, as shown in Fig. 5, for gripping the pieces of wood of the second assortment while simultaneously holding the pieces of wood of the first assortment via the gripping arms 13, 14. Fig. 6 shows how pieces of wood of the different assortments are held by the gripping unit separated from each other to be carried to the cargo space. Fig. 7 illustrates how the pieces of wood of the usual assortment can be laid down separately in the cargo space by first moving the gripping means 7, 8 to their slack layer for laying the pieces of wood 20 according to the second assortment in a stable in the cargo space 2 while retaining the pieces of wood 19 of the first assortment in gripper unit subspace 17. Drap the gripper unit to a stable for laying pieces of wood according to the first assortment and there the extra gripper arms are taken to their slack layer for separate laying of the pieces of wood. In the embodiment of the gripping assembly shown in Fig. 2, the two extra gripping arms 13, 14 are arranged to be removable into an inactive bearing in which they are arranged outside the annular space 11, so that they are not in the carriage and take up space when wishes to grip and lift a large collective catch without the need for sorting, for example when unloading from the forwarder's cargo space or when picking up assortment timber, as illustrated in Fig. 8.
